Output 0ba45e7efb0261eaf32af23398b7f9cd0a1e2e267c5c3d0aac7e6d7b0c33c5e2:19

value
514886
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fbe482de98812d4004aa591189c720f8deab96de OP_EQUALVERIFY OP_CHECKSIG
address
1PxtMPRUbsxBxDEDwbepy612X62d7QPMZL
transaction
0ba45e7efb0261eaf32af23398b7f9cd0a1e2e267c5c3d0aac7e6d7b0c33c5e2
confirmations
125306
spent
true